ASN Aircraft accident de Havilland Canada DHC-3 Otter VP-FAM Stonington Island
ASN logo
 

Status:
Date:Monday 3 March 1969
Type:Silhouette image of generic DHC3 model; specific model in this crash may look slightly different
de Havilland Canada DHC-3 Otter
Operator:British Antarctic Survey
Registration: VP-FAM
MSN: 395
First flight: 1960
Crew:Fatalities: 0 / Occupants:
Passengers:Fatalities: 0 / Occupants:
Total:Fatalities: 0 / Occupants:
Aircraft damage: Damaged beyond repair
Location:Stonington Island (   Antarctica)
Phase: Unknown (UNK)
Nature:Unknown
Departure airport:?
Destination airport:?
Narrative:
Crash landed following engine failure.
